1.1 ! root 1: ! 2: ! 3: C keywords Overview C keywords ! 4: ! 5: ! 6: ! 7: ! 8: A keyword is a word that is reserved within C, and must not be ! 9: used to name variables, functions, or macros. COHERENT recog- ! 10: nizes the following C keywords: ! 11: ! 12: ! 13: alien extern signed ! 14: auto float sizeof ! 15: break for static ! 16: case goto struct ! 17: char if switch ! 18: const int typedef ! 19: continue long union ! 20: default readonly unsigned ! 21: do register void ! 22: double return volatile ! 23: else short while ! 24: enum ! 25: ! 26: ! 27: In conformity with the ANSI standard, the keyword entry is no ! 28: longer recognized. The keywords const and volatile are now ! 29: recognized, but not implemented. ! 30: ! 31: ***** See Also ***** ! 32: ! 33: C language ! 34: ! 35: ! 36: ! 37: ! 38: ! 39: ! 40: ! 41: ! 42: ! 43: ! 44: ! 45: ! 46: ! 47: ! 48: ! 49: ! 50: ! 51: ! 52: ! 53: ! 54: ! 55: ! 56: ! 57: ! 58: ! 59: ! 60: ! 61: ! 62: ! 63: ! 64: COHERENT Lexicon Page 1 ! 65: ! 66:
